Batstone Surname Meaning

English: habitational name from Batson in Salcombe (Devon). The placename is from the Old English personal name Bada + stān ‘stone’.

Source: Dictionary of American Family Names 2nd edition, 2022

Where is the Batstone family from?

You can see how Batstone families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Batstone family name was found in the USA, the UK, Canada, and Scotland between 1840 and 1920. The most Batstone families were found in United Kingdom in 1891. In 1891 there were 106 Batstone families living in London. This was about 31% of all the recorded Batstone's in United Kingdom. London had the highest population of Batstone families in 1891.

What did your Batstone ancestors do for a living?

In 1939, Farmer and Unpaid Domestic Duties were the top reported jobs for men and women in the United Kingdom named Batstone. 37% of Batstone men worked as a Farmer and 72% of Batstone women worked as an Unpaid Domestic Duties.
